The Arizona Long Term Care System (ALTCS, pronounced ALL-Tecs) is health insurance for individuals who are age 65 or older, or who have a disability, and who require nursing facility level of care. Services may be provided in an institution or in a home or community-based setting. Those who qualify do not have to reside in a nursing home.

The AHCCCS Housing Program (AHP) consists of AHCCCS Permanent Supportive Housing (PSH) programs. AHP should comply with SAMHSA’s PSH program elements The AHCCCS Housing Program is a Permanent Supportive Housing (PSH) program with two primary models: scattered site, tenant-based rental assistance (vouchers) and site-based, project-based rental assistance in the Community Living Program.

AHCCCS Receives Federal Approval of 5-Year Waiver Renewal October 14, 2022. PHOENIX — The Centers for Medicare and Medicaid Services (CMS) approved Arizona’s request for a five-year extension of its 1115 Waiver, the agreement with the federal government that authorizes the Arizona Health Care Cost Containment System (AHCCCS) to reform and modernize the State’s Medicaid program.

Apr 21, 2022 · April 21, 2022 Contractors Selected to Develop New Transitional Housing Facility and Co-Located Clinic. AHCCCS has awarded a new contract to two collaborative vendors who will provide housing and health care services in a new transitional housing facility for individuals experiencing homelessness and living with a Serious Mental Illness (SMI) designation. The AHCCCS Housing Program (AHP) consists of both permanent supportive housing and supportive services. The majority of AHCCCS available housing funding is reserved for members with a designation of Serious Mental Illness (SMI), although limited housing is provided for some individuals without an SMI designation who are considered to have a General Mental Health and/or Substance Use Disorder ... AHCCCS Housing Program resources are limited and have a waitlist for housing subsidies. We encourage members in need of housing to apply for other housing subsidy programs like those offered by cities and counties, as well as other homelessness support programs. Jul 10, 2020 · AHCCCS is Arizona’s Medicaid program that provides health insurance for people with limited income and resources. It covers programs for acute and long term care, behavioral health and children’s care. Currently the program enrolls nearly 2 million Arizona residents.
